- Invalid Data: CBC &1's Action not active ?The SAP error message
/ACCGO/MCK_MSG_MAINT042 Invalid Data: CBC &1's Action not active
typically relates to issues in the context of the SAP Central Business Configuration (CBC) or the SAP S/4HANA Cloud. This error indicates that a specific action or configuration related to a CBC entity is not currently active or valid.Cause:
- Inactive Action: The action associated with the CBC entity (denoted by
&1
) is not activated. This could be due to a configuration oversight or a missing activation step.- Configuration Issues: There may be inconsistencies or errors in the configuration settings that prevent the action from being recognized as active.
- Transport Issues: If the configuration was transported from another system, there might have been issues during the transport process that led to the action not being activated.
- Authorization Issues: The user may not have the necessary authorizations to view or activate the action.
